or the publishers unless expressly stated to be such. The Baltic Exchange
is the world’s premier and oldest international shipping market.
Most of the world’s open market bulk cargo chartering is negotiated
at some stage by Baltic members who represent leading international companies.
Other activities include the world’s most important market for buying
and selling ships, specialist freight by air and commodity dealing. The
Baltic Exchange operates a strict code of business ethics encapsulated
in its motto ‘Our Word Our Bond’. The Baltic Exchange disclaims
